Im looking for an exhaust and from lookin at pictures here at the forum I seem to like how those 2 look. However I want a system with a nice sound (like the SI has) - I dont want it to sound like a broken lawnmower. - not too loud but I want a nice clean performance sound.
Can you guys help me and or give me some pointers?
I have an injen CAI, but will soon replace it with an AEM V2 and add headers.

when u look directly at the muffler tip straight, it looks ugly, but from an angle, it looks real nice. i like my apexi wsI, only con was it wiggles over rough roads when the car hits dips,bumps,etc. the sound of the wsI is real nice and not loud unless your running straight pipes like me. its pretty much mild toned and doesnt get loud as much as the other exhaust systems offered on the market. i dont know how to compare it to the rsr so i cant say about that one.
I just had my RS*R Exmag installed today and it definitely is fu**ing sweet!
As soon as pulled out of the driveway I could notice a torque increase from 2k RPMS and up.
It's very quiet which I was looking for but it has a nice deep tone.. sounds mean when you get on it.. It's ceramic coated stainless steel which means it'll probably outlast your car. I think it's the best catback out there.. (I did a lot of research) and keep in mind that Exmag is chambered for torque not horsepower so you probably won't gain much at high rpms.
I'm runing it on a 6th gen EX (canadian Si) with AEM CAI.
